Brugmansia season is Spring, Summer, Fall and Winter and Blue Hibiscus season is Spring, Summer, Fall and Winter. The type of soil for Brugmansia is Loam, Sand and for Blue Hibiscus is Clay, Loam, Sand while the PH of soil for Brugmansia is Acidic, Neutral and for Blue Hibiscus is Acidic, Neutral, Alkaline.
Brugmansia and Blue Hibiscus physical information is very important for comparison. Brugmansia height is 180.00 cm and width 120.00 cm whereas Blue Hibiscus height is 120.00 cm and width 120.00 cm. The color specification of Brugmansia and Blue Hibiscus are as follows:
Brugmansia flower color: White and Pink
Brugmansia leaf color: Green
Blue Hibiscus flower color: Blue, Purple and Blue Violet
